Bruno Tonioli’s job on Dancing With the Stars is not to be Mr. Nice, but he’s definitely crossed the line with his comments to Karina Smirnoff and Ralph Macchio’s salsa. Viewers and the couple’s supporters are still shocked Bruno could be so vulgar and rude on a family show.
As the video below will show, Karina and Ralph did their best for a very energetic salsa. Clearly, the public loved it – and one can easily say that judging by how loudly they cheered and applauded at the end of it.
As far as judges were concerned, they didn’t really appreciate it, because it was too “rough,” too “aggressive” and lacking “rhythm.”
Of the three, Bruno probably hated it the most, if one is to take into consideration the comments he made at the end, which literally drew gasps from the viewers and left some members of the audience with their mouth hanging open.
“You definitely went for a bad [expletive] salsa. Are you wearing extra large diapers,” Bruno asked, as the two dancers were still trying to figure out whether he was about to praise them or not.
Turns out, Bruno didn’t have the slightest intention of doing so.
“Your legs were too far apart – about a mile apart while you were dancing,” he said, explaining the diaper comment.
And then he added, “And you were too rough with your [expletive]!” A collective gasp is heard in the audience, because everybody assumed he was talking to Karina.
Trying to make things right, Bruno added that he was actually talking to Ralph and that the term he chose was in reference to Karina’s costume.
“A pussycat, what is she? You have to be a little bit smoother,” he added, but the damage was already done.
After she recovered from the shock and insult, Karina herself admonished Bruno, telling him he’d been “classy” in his comment.
Judge Carrie Ann Inaba also believed the same, saying Bruno needed a muzzle and praising the couple for their effort.
